Observation Care: Don't Make this $259 Observation Coding Mistake
WPS Medicare outlines exactly why one provider’s documentation didn’t pass muster.
You may save a few minutes at the hospital by skimping on documentation so you can move onto the next patient, but you’ll hurt yourself in the end when your MAC requests repayments due to insufficient medical records. Don’t believe it? Consider this example that Part B payer WPS Medicare recently reported among its Comprehensive Error Rate Testing (CERT) issues.
